当前位置:   article > 正文

探索 PostgreSQL JDBC 驱动:连接 Java 和 PostgreSQL 数据库的高效桥梁

pg jdbc驱动

探索 PostgreSQL JDBC 驱动:连接 Java 和 PostgreSQL 数据库的高效桥梁

项目地址:https://gitcode.com/pgjdbc/pgjdbc

PostgreSQL JDBC 是一个优秀的开源项目,它为 Java 开发人员提供了一个强大的工具,使其能够通过 JDBC(Java Database Connectivity)接口与 PostgreSQL 数据库进行无缝通信。这个项目的源代码托管在 Gitcode 上,便于开发者查阅和贡献。

项目简介

PostgreSQL JDBC 驱动是一个类型 4 的 JDBC 驱动程序,这意味着它是完全基于 Java 编写的,无需数据库供应商特定的软件,即可直接与 PostgreSQL 数据库服务器交互。这个驱动程序实现了 Java.sql 包中定义的所有接口和类,使得使用 Java 进行数据库操作变得简单易行。

技术分析

  • 100% 纯 Java:由于是纯 Java 实现,该驱动可以在任何支持 Java 的平台上运行,提供了跨平台的能力。

  • 全面的 API 支持:这个驱动程序完全支持 JDBC 规范,包括 Connection、Statement、PreparedStatement、CallableStatement、ResultSet 等对象,让开发人员可以利用熟悉的 JDBC 语法来执行 SQL 查询和管理事务。

  • 性能优化:pgjdbc 项目持续优化性能,减少网络开销,提高数据传输效率,使得大规模数据操作变得更加流畅。

  • 异步 I/O 支持:利用非阻塞 I/O 模型,能够在高并发场景下提升系统响应速度。

  • 线程安全:驱动程序设计时考虑了多线程环境的安全性,避免了在并发环境下可能引发的问题。

  • JDBC 4.2 兼容:支持最新的 JDBC 标准,包括 JSON 函数和局部时间区处理。

应用场景

  • Web 应用开发:在构建基于 Java 的 Web 应用时,可以轻松地将 PostgreSQL 作为后端数据库

  • 大数据处理:由于其高性能和稳定性,pgjdbc 适用于需要处理大量数据的场景,如数据分析和机器学习应用。

  • 分布式系统:在分布式系统中,通过 JDBC 驱动可以方便地进行跨节点的数据交互。

  • 教学与研究:对于学习 Java 数据库编程或数据库管理系统的学生和研究人员,这是一个理想的学习资源。

特点

  1. 活跃社区:项目拥有一个活跃的开发社区,不断修复问题并添加新特性,确保项目的稳定性和先进性。

  2. 文档丰富:详细的 API 文档和使用示例帮助快速上手,同时也提供了故障排除指南。

  3. 可定制化:允许开发者根据具体需求自定义配置,比如连接池设置、SSL 加密等。

  4. 兼容性广泛:不仅支持最新的 PostgreSQL 数据库版本,也兼容较旧的版本。

  5. 开源许可证:使用宽松的 LGPLv2.1 许可证,鼓励自由使用和修改。

要开始使用 pgjdbc,只需将其添加到你的 Java 项目的依赖管理中,并按照标准 JDBC 方式建立连接。访问项目仓库 https://gitcode.com/pgjdbc/pgjdbc 获取最新信息,阅读文档以了解更多信息,或者参与社区讨论,共同推动项目的进步。

让我们一起探索 PostgreSQL JDBC 驱动的强大功能,开启便捷的 Java 数据库开发之旅吧!

项目地址:https://gitcode.com/pgjdbc/pgjdbc

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/凡人多烦事01/article/detail/489883
推荐阅读
相关标签
  

闽ICP备14008679号